Execution Grounds (EG) lies just east of Dion, and is within a quick 5 minutes' run from the town.

History of Execution Grounds

Long ago, a pleasant revolt occured in Dion but was suppressed by the local lord. The lord had the rebels executed en masse in this location. In Aden, the dead do not lie easy, and this place is now haunted by the spirits of the executed.

Mobs

EG has mobs of various levels, as listed below:

    • Mandragora Blossoms
    • Mandragora Sapling
    • Mandragora Sprouts
    • Specters
    • Sorrow Maidens
    • Neer
    • Neer Berzerkers
    • Amber Basilisks
    • Strains
    • Ghouls
    • Dead Seekers
    • Granite Golems
    • Hangman Trees


These varies from the mid 20's to low 30s'. The density of mobs is fairly high.

Thus, the range and concentration of mobs makes EG an ideal place for PCs who have completed their 1st Profession Change and has leveled to around level 23 or level 24.

In terms of aggressiveness and social behaviours, Mandagora Sprouts, Sorrow Maidens, Strains, Dead Seekers, Ghouls and Granite Golems are non-aggressive; Strains are also non-social. Everything else is aggressive, and social to boot.

This makes hunting in EG a bit dangerous, but EG is sufficiently big that the mobs are typically spawned independently. Moreover, the mobs are typically segregated by tiers, so you don't - often - run into trains in EG. The potential is there and it does happen, especially with Hangman Trees and Neers, but it occurs less frequently than one may think.

Layout

EG is laid out in 3 layers. For simplicity, they are:

    • the bottom layer
    • the second layer or second tier
    • the top layer or top tier


In addition, there are two areas of interest. They are:

    • the Mandragora breeding pits
    • the Pit


EG Bottom Layer

The bottom layer, which is connected to Dion via the east gate, has the highest level mobs, and is typically not the place a low level (< level 24) PC should be - a lot of the mobs there can make your day fairly messy. Mobs there include Mandragora Blossoms, Mandragora Saplings, Mandragora Sprouts, Strains, Dead Seekers, Granite Golems and Hangman Trees.

The bottom layer is dominated by trees and a huge gullotine surrounded by Hangman Trees.

Of special note is that in the middle (roughly) of this bottom layer is a road intersection. PCs typically call in the crossroad or x-road or similar, and it is here that dwarves tends to set up shop selling Soul and Spirit Shots. Soul Shots are more common, and it is not unknown for a PC to repeatedly request for Spirit Shots without getting any.

Due to the promixity to Dion, prices for these shots tend to be at market value, but occassionally people do raise the prices, especially if no other sellers are around.

The crossroad is also the place where most PCs go to rest. The location has a few spawns, but the mobs spawned are all non-aggro, so it is a fairly safe location to rest. There are a few other locations in EG that is "safe", but none quite like the crossroad.

EG Second Tier

The second level is merely a pair of intermediate tiers that connect to the top layer. These are smallish "arenas" that contain mid- and high- level mobs: the southern tier contains mainly aggressive Neers and Neer Berzerkers, which the northern tier, Strains and Amber Basilisks. There are a few Hangman Trees on each tier.
